Technical Definition

The register scc name PV Generated Energy Total at address 13074 is used to monitor scc name pv generated energy total on the Epever Scc Entities Sensor.

  • Protocol: Modbus RTU
  • Data Type: U DWORD R
  • Unit: kWh
  • Access: Read Only

💡 Engineer's Insight

Analysis: Total energy generated by the solar charge controller (SCC) in kWh or MWh. Indicates cumulative system performance.

Troubleshooting: Zero value may indicate a new installation, a reset of the SCC, or a communication error preventing energy accumulation.
